Full Screen View
In the past, you could view your plans without a static task bar at the top of the page. This was ideal for those of us who show our "Day" view plans as an agenda on a projector screen in our classrooms. Can you add this back, or put this idea in motion?
1 voteWe’ve added a new “Full Screen” icon, next to the Search icon, to allow you to switch to Full Screen mode, where the header area is no longer locked in place. When in Full Screen mode, you’ll also be able to print via the Browser Print Icon. We hope this helps, any questions please let us know at support@planbook.com. Thanks!

Align calendar popup with current view date
The calendar button should give you the month in which the lessons you are currently looking at were taught. For example, if I am looking at a lesson I taught in March of last year and want to see the previous month's lessons, I should be able to click the calendar button and go forward or back a month from where I am. Right now the calendar button brings up the current month; to move forward or backward in previous years I must click the little blue arrows many times. Very irritating!

Size of Date at Top
I project my daily lessons on my white board; it would be kind of nice if the date at the top was larger so my students could see it better when they are heading their papers. Thank you!
1 voteGood news! You can now control the size of your date header. Click Go To > Display Settings > Global Settings to select a font and size for your dates.
